Food Drink Devon's 2024 finalists

Food Drink Devon has announced this year’s shortlist of finalists for its annual awards ceremony

Food Drink Devon's 2024 finalists

Image: RAW PR and Marketing Ltd

After reportedly receiving an extraordinary number of entries, Food Drink Devon is building anticipation for October’s Food Drink Devon Awards Ceremony with its impressive line-up of Devon-based finalists.

The organisation, which represents a membership of Devon's leading food and drink producers, speciality retailers, hospitality, and catering businesses, is committed to raising Devon's profile both nationally and internationally.

Since entries closed in April, a panel of judges and industry experts have sampled over 340 products, visited 107 hospitality venues, explored 17 retail outlets, and experienced 9 training schools to identify the very best Devon has to offer.

Jack Pickering, board director of Food Drink Devon, said: “We are thrilled to celebrate the exceptional quality and diversity of this year's entrants into our awards. From innovative products to outstanding venues, Devon's food and drink community spirit shone brightly during our 2024 judging.

“It's a testament to the hard work and creativity of everyone in the industry. We have so much to be proud of, and we can't wait to honour these achievements.”

The award categories include:

  • Product Awards
  • Retail Awards: Best Retailer and Best Online Retailer
  • Hospitality Awards: Best Fine Dining Restaurant; Best Restaurant; Best Hotel Restaurant; and Best Pub
  • Hospitality Awards: Best Cafe and Best Takeaway
  • Training School Awards
  • Sustainability Pioneer Award
  • The new Devon Wine of the Year Award

Susy Atkins, Food Drink Devon board director and wine writer and presenter, commented: “The number of entries in the drinks section of this year’s awards was much higher than ever before, and our expert judges, including myself, were really impressed by the overall standard. 

“Devon's drinks scene is diverse and inspiring. The standard of the Devon wines was excellent, and we are delighted with the first winner of our new ‘Devon Wine of the Year’ award.”

Covering food production, preparation, retailing, cooking, and service, the Food Drink Devon Awards honour businesses demonstrating a consistent commitment to quality, sustainability, provenance, excellent customer service, and support for their local communities and other local businesses. 

Judging for the awards is carried out by a panel of independent and unbiased experts.

The judges this year are Rebecca Mitchell, Marc Millon, Fiona Beckett, Andy Clarke, Orlando Murrin, Steve Ashworth, and Sue Stoneman. 

A spokesperson for Food Drink Devon said: “A special thank you goes to sponsors of the awards DCW Polymers, West Country Fruit Sales, Empire Services, Caterfood, Bays Brewery, Ocean City Media, Vigo, Impact Design & Marketing, Vale Labels, inkREADible Labels, Stephens Scown, PL1 Events, and Hedgerow Print.”

All results and winners are verified by an independent adjudicator, with entrants receiving the opportunity to benefit from invaluable product feedback provided by the panel. 

Winners will be announced during the organisation’s black tie award ceremony on Monday, October 7, at Sandy Park, home of the Exeter Chiefs.
